Myocardial viability and revascularization surgery

Description

Full text: : To evaluate the contribution of the myocardium viability study with Thallium-210, after acute myocardial infarction (AMI), in the results of the myocardial revascularization surgery (CABG) in patients with severe compromising of the left ventricular function and without evidence of residual ischemia. Retrospective study of 310 patients (P) submitted to CABG between January 1994 to June 1996. From these, 14 (10 male, 71,4%) with average of 60,2 years old (39-73), with AMI antecedent, severe illness of 3 blood vessels, ejection fraction (EF) lower to 30%, viability in the isotopic study and absence of residual ischemia. All the patients made radionuclide angiography, more or less 1 month before 4 and 6 months after the surgery. We compared the obtained EF values and considered statistically significant the value of p<0,05. 3 by-pass were, in media, implanted, being used in everybody the pedicled left internal mammary artery for the anterior descendent artery. In 3 patients were also used the right internal mammary artery. The media value of the EF were of 21,5 + 5,9% (11 a 29%) before the surgery and of 36,7 + 8,5% (26-50%) 4 to 6 months after (p=0,003). In patients with severe coronary illness, low EF and without evidence of ischemia, the viability existence of the isotopic study allows us to identify the patients that probably were more benefited by the surgical treatment
